Monitoring well installation follows ASTM D5092 (Standard Practice for Design and Installation of Groundwater Monitoring Wells). Proper construction ensures representative groundwater samples and prevents cross-contamination between aquifer zones. Wells must be designed for the specific hydrogeological conditions and target contaminants at each site.
Well Materials
- PVC (Schedule 40): Most common for routine monitoring. Low cost, chemically resistant to most inorganics. Not suitable for chlorinated solvent sites (sorption) or NAPL investigations.
- Stainless Steel (304/316): Required for VOC/SVOC investigations. Inert to organic solvents. Higher cost but eliminates sorption bias.
- PTFE (Teflon): Highest inertness. Used for trace-level organic investigations. Very expensive, rarely standard.
- Standard diameter: 50 mm (2 in.) for sampling-only wells; 100 mm (4 in.) for wells requiring pump installation.
Screen Selection
- Slot size: Typically 0.010 in. (0.254 mm) or 0.020 in. (0.508 mm). Selected based on formation grain size analysis.
- Screen length: 1.5 m (5 ft) standard for point-of-compliance wells; up to 3 m (10 ft) for water table wells in unconfined aquifers.
- Screen placement: Straddle the water table for unconfined aquifers; place within the target zone for confined aquifers.
- Material: Must match casing material. Factory-cut machine slots preferred over hand-cut.
Filter Pack & Grouting
- Filter pack: Clean silica sand (e.g., #2 or #3 Monterey sand) placed around the screen, extending 0.6 m (2 ft) above the screen top.
- Transition seal: Fine sand or bentonite pellets (minimum 0.3 m / 1 ft) above filter pack to prevent grout migration into screen zone.
- Annular seal: Bentonite grout (20-30% solids) or cement-bentonite mix from transition seal to surface. Tremie-grouted from bottom up.
- Hydration: Bentonite pellets require minimum 30-minute hydration before grouting above. Do not rush.
Surface Completion
- Flush-mount: Traffic-rated vaults set in concrete pad for areas with vehicle traffic. J-plug or locking cap inside.
- Stick-up: Protective steel casing (stickup guard) with locking cap, set in concrete pad. 0.6-1 m above grade. Bollard protection if in traffic areas.
- Concrete pad: Minimum 0.6 m x 0.6 m, sloped away from well to prevent surface water infiltration.
- Survey: All wells surveyed for top-of-casing elevation (to 0.01 ft / 0.003 m) and horizontal coordinates (sub-meter GPS minimum).
